If you haven’t already had your sewer lines inspected, you should consider scheduling an inspection as soon as possible. A professional plumber in Montgomery County PA can use a video camera to examine the line and pinpoint any problems. Then, they can recommend the right repair option.

When you have a clogged drain, the first sign is probably slow drainage. Over time, this can lead to a complete blockage that requires emergency sewer repair in montgomery County PA. Sewage backups can be dangerous for your family because they contain bacteria and parasites that can cause health issues.

You might also notice that your toilets have a strange odor. This is because the sewage is mixing with water and releasing gases into your home. A foul odor is a clear indication that your sewer line needs repair.

Another sign to watch out for is squelching noises from your yard. If you hear these sounds, it means that the soil around your sewer line is being pulled away by the leaking sewage. This can lead to a sinkhole in your yard, which is very expensive to repair.

Other signs that you need to call for sewer repairs include gurgling from your drains, a tree root invading your pipe, and sewage seeping out of your toilet. The longer you wait to get these repairs done, the more expensive and hazardous they will become.

A quality plumbing company in Montgomery County PA will be able to provide you with a wide variety of sewer repair options, from traditional dig and replace methods to trenchless alternatives like pipe lining. Trenchless methods require less digging and are more environmentally friendly. They can also be much quicker to implement and complete.

In the past, repairing or replacing sewer pipes was often a labor-intensive and costly project. However, technological advancements in the plumbing industry have made these processes much faster and less invasive. Today, you can choose from a variety of different pipe materials including durable plastics and cast iron that are designed to last for decades.

You can even opt for a no-dig solution where your plumber creates a new pipe inside the old one using polyethylene or similar long-lasting material. This method is called pipe lining and it eliminates the need for messy excavation and makes your sewer system more efficient.

Another sign that your water heater is nearing the end of its lifespan is rusty or sandy-looking water. This is likely due to mineral deposits that build up over time in your water heater. It’s important to clean your water heater regularly to prevent this problem.

Water Heater Installation Services in Montgomery County PA

The dip tube is another common water heater part that can wear out over time and become clogged. This causes cool water to mix with hot water, which reduces your overall water temperature. Replacing the dip tube can cost from $50 to $200, depending on the size of your heater.

You should get your water heater flushed at least once every three to five years. The process involves draining your water heater to remove sediment that can build up and clog your drain valve. It also includes a complete inspection of the entire water heater. One of the best ways to spot leaks in your home or business is by using a water meter. This is the easiest way to spot a leak because it allows you to see exactly how much water you are using. If you find that your meter is constantly changing, it could mean that you have a leak.

Another way to check if you have a leak is by looking for soft or discoloration areas on floors, walls and around showers and bathtubs. If you have a tiled shower, you will want to check the caulking at the joints to look for cracks and mold. If you see any of these things, it is important to fix them before they cause more problems.

If you do find a leak, it is important to call in a professional plumber in Montgomery County PA to take care of the problem. These professionals can easily identify any hidden leaks that you may have and can fix them for you.

Some of the most common plumbing leaks include dripping faucets, toilets that don’t flush properly and outdoor irrigation systems. Repairing these types of leaks can save you hundreds of gallons of water each month and also help you to become more energy efficient.
